Rafael Pondé, an accomplished Philadelphia-based musician, originally from Diamba, Salvador, in The State of Bahia, Brazil, promotes cultural understanding and combats racism through music.
Early recognition began in 1999, when he participated in the Bahian Music Festival by University of Vitória da Conquista. Here he and The Curipri Band won the blessing of Waly Salomão, one of the greatest “Tropicalia” poets.This led to Rafael being placed in the hall of the greats “novissimos baianos.” Waly traveled with the young Rafael to São Paulo to record the program “Música brasileira” in the studios of Trama, with João Marcelo Bôscoli, the son of the legendary Elis Regina.
Rafael has recorded four albums, and has toured Europe and Latin America, and played in The Weltkulture festival in Germany.
In 2016, Rafael was elected as “Brazilian cultural ambassador” for the program “Partners of America.” His workshops and speeches share Brazilian culture and focus on building cultural understanding and overcoming racism through music and the arts.
